8 Upper Rosemary Hall and 1A Richards Close is a Grade II listed building in the Warwick local planning authority area, England. First listed on 10 November 1971. House.

UPPER ROSEMARY HILL (south side) No 8 and RICHARDS CLOSE, No 1A

(Formerly listed as No 8 UPPER ROSEMARY HILL)

II. C18. Red brick; two storeys; two flush casements, cambered arches. Canted bay each side lower storey, each with boxed bay window. Recessed six-fielded panelled door with moulded panelled wood canopy. Corbelled brick eaves; two gabled dormers; old tiled roof. First floor moulded band.
